This icon means a potentially hazardous situation which, if not avoided, could result in death or
serious injury.
Obey the following warnings:
Read and understand all warnings on this machine.
Carefully read and understand the Assembly Manual.
Keep bystanders and children away from the product you are assembling at all times.
Do not connect power supply to the machine until instructed to do so.
Do not assemble this machine outdoors or in a wet or moist location.
Make sure assembly is done in an appropriate work space away from foot traffic and exposure to
bystanders.
Some components of the machine can be heavy or awkward. Use a second person when doing the
assembly steps involving these parts. Do not do steps that involve heavy lifting or awkward movements
on your own.
Set up this machine on a solid, level, horizontal surface.
Do not try to change the design or functionality of this machine. This could compromise the safety of
this machine and will void the warranty.
If replacement parts are necessary, use only genuine Nautilus® replacement parts and hardware.
Failure to use genuine replacement parts can cause a risk to users, keep the machine from operating
correctly and void the warranty.
Do not use the machine until the machine has been fully assembled and inspected for correct
performance in accordance with the Owner's Manual.
Read and understand the complete Owner's Manual supplied with this machine before first use.
Keep the Owner's and Assembly Manuals for future reference.
Do all assembly steps in the sequence given. Incorrect assembly can lead to injury.
